-4

可能重复:
Javascript/PHP 我可以获取 GPS 位置并将其发送给我吗?

好的,这就是我想要的:

我需要 Javascript 或 PHP 脚本之类的东西来从访问者那里获取 gps 位置,然后偷偷发送给我(我不会用这个坏的,它是用于防止我的 iPhone 被盗的网站)

我希望如果小偷打开网站(我将使用 webclip、命名 Safari 并给出 safari 图标)我会自动获取他的位置并将他重定向到谷歌或其他

所以基本上是这样的:

navigator.geolocation.getCurrentPosition(GetLocation);
function GetLocation(location) {
    //Some script that sends the location secretly to me
}
{
    windows.location="http://google.com";
}

你能帮我吗?

PS:我不会用这个坏的,因为它只会在我的 iPhone 上,我知道有它的应用程序,但那些要花钱,我不知道它是否值得。

更新:

我发现了以下内容:我不知道它到底做了什么,但我猜它需要该位置并将其发送到 location.php ???

function ajaxFunction() {
$.ajax({
  url:'location.php',
  type:'POST',
  data:'lat='+lat+'&long='+long,
  success:function(d){
    console.log(d);
  },
  error(w,t,f){
    console.log(w+' '+t+' '+f);
  }
});
}

现在我如何让它重定向到谷歌并将它放在我的网站上?

4

1 回答 1

0

打开站点并授予它访问该位置的权限,选择“记住此决定”或任何选项。那么提示以后就不会出现了。

但是,为此编写一个应用程序可能是一个更好的主意。

于 2012-04-14T09:02:25.260 回答